Small college has 2523 students in 1994 and 2891 students in 1996 if the enrollment follows a linear growth pattern how many stu

dents should the college have in 2006?

Since it is specified that the relationship is linear, you could think of a linear graph for this. The base year would be 1994. The first point is at (0,2523) while the second point is (2,2891). The slope would be

m = (2891 - 2523)/(2-0) = 184

The slope-intercept form is y = mx + b. Let's substitute (0,2523) to the equation such that
2523 = 184(0)+b
b = 2523

Hence, the equation of the linear graph is y = 184x + 2523. Now, at 2006, x = 2006 - 1994 = 12 years.

y = 184(12) + 2523 = 4,731 students

Thyroxine is also known as T4. The number 4 represents four atoms of
Darina [25.2K]
The number 4 represents four atoms of iodine per molecule. Thyroxine is a type of hormone produced by the thyroid gland and this hormone controls human's metabolism process. There are two hormones produced by the thyroid gland, the thyroxine and the triiodothyronine, which also control human's metabolism process. These hormones consisted of iodine atoms in each of the molecule, which human gets from eating salt.
